The enclosed product information is INCREDIBLY DETAILED, and here goes supplying all of it:

It claims this filter removes more chlorine than any other model, reminds you to thread the teflon tape clockwise, and includes an exploded diagram, which shows the optional showerhead this company sells (not that you''d think getting their model gives you an advantage over a well-reviewed alternative). It claims to remove 75% of free chlorine for six months or 5000 gallons, whichever comes first.

It says it removes "Combined Chlorine (Sodium Hypochlorite) and Hydrogen Sulfide the latter of which they say causes an odor in the water, but they don''t give percentages for the last two. They list it as tested and certified by "NSF International" to remove the 75% of free chlorine, whoever NSF is. It says their system removes more chlorine "at a wider temperature range." Maximum operating temperature is 120 degrees and maximum pressure it''ll tolerate is 125 lbs per square inch. And a tiny disclaimer that "actual performance may vary." It says NSF International has NOT tested the product''s ability to reduce free chlorine "in the presence of chloramines" if this stuff is used to treat your water. There are some "Notes on NFS Test Protocol" but it''s quite technical, though a useful data point about NSF standards is a passing test result removes 50% of free chlorine (compared to their 75% result). Lots of useful information for a smallish pamphlet.

Crane EE-5200B FFP Crane Warm Mist Humidifier, Black, 1 GallonI''ve been using humdifiers for years and have tried every type. The cool mist ones mildew up quickly and the wicks are expensive. The ultrasonics are nice, but unless you use distilled water, you run the risk of breathing in bacteria from tap water, since the mist is cool and the water and any particulates that are in the water are nebulized into the air. The warm mist are the best, since the water is boiled and only the steam escapes. I have used many brands of warm mist humidifiers over the years... Holmes, Duracraft, and Honeywell. This Crane model is THE BEST yet. It hasn''t leaked once. The tank size is adequate for a medium sized bedroom. I run mine on the low setting and it goes for 12 hours easily. The operation is quiet. The other brands I''ve tired all have the same basic design... the heating element is round with a hole in the middle and is difficult to scrub on all sides if there is a lot of hard water build up. This design has a solid heating element built into the bottom of the unit and can be scrubbed easily with a brush to remove build up. There is some basic weekly maintenance required, but it''s not difficult. You need to use distilled white vinegar to dissolve build up and disinfect. I needed humidifiers for a couple of rooms and I wasn''t sure whether to go with this Crane humidifier or the Vicks V745A. Both had pretty good reviews, had similar capacities, were about the same price, etc. So I picked up the Vicks model at a local store, and I ordered the Crane from Amazon.

Both models are very similar in the way they generate steam, but there are a couple of significant differences that makes me prefer the Vicks model over the Crane.

For starters, the low setting of the Crane outputs about the same amount of steam as the high setting of the Vicks, and it turns out that the Crane is a 400 watt unit, while the Vicks is only about 275 watts. I keep the Crane on its low setting overnight in the bedroom, and the water tank is almost empty by morning. The Vicks needs to be on its high setting to go through the same amount of water in the same period of time.

Second, the design of the water tank on the Crane makes it harder to fill than on the Vicks. Neither one has a tank that will fit under my bathroom sink faucet, so I have to fill them in the shower. And although the filler hole on the Crane is wider, it lacks a handle like the Vicks model has, and filling it under the shower faucet is kind of awkward.

Next, once the tank is in place on the Crane model, the bottom of the tank sits in a lot more water than does the Vicks. Not sure this is really a problem, but when you remove the tank for cleaning (there''s both daily and weekly cleaning recommended for both), it drips more water on the floor. Also, the filler cap on the Crane has developed a little bit of a musty odor, and again I''m not sure if it''s from sitting in more water on a constant basis.

Finally, I find the Crane model to be a bit more difficult to clean than the Vicks. The space around the heating element is much narrower, making it hard to wipe around with a cloth. The Crane also accumulates more rust deposits than the Vicks, which is probably because of its higher wattage heating element.
